RUTH KERNS JOBE
(February 16, 2015)



RUTH KERNS JOBE, 83, of Huntington, widow of Robert Jobe, passed away Monday, February 16, 2015, at Heritage Manor. Funeral services will be conducted at 1 p.m. Friday at the Reger Funeral Chapel by Pastor Carol McKay. Burial will follow in Spring Valley Memory Gardens, Huntington. She was born February 28, 1931, in McDowell County, W.Va., a daughter of the late Retus and Ruth Atwell Kerns. She was a hearing assistant with the Social Security Administration and a volunteer at Cabell Huntington Hospital and St. Mary's Medical Center. Ruth was a member of the Lavalette United Methodist Church. In addition to her husband and parents she was preceded in death by her daughter Patricia Diane Bias. Survivors include her son-in-law George William Bias and grandson David Matthew Bias. Friends may call from 5 to 7 p.m. Thursday at the Reger Funeral Home.
